com.espertech.esper.epl.join.exec.composite
Interface CompositeIndexQuery

All Known Implementing Classes:
CompositeIndexQueryKeyed, CompositeIndexQueryRange

public interface CompositeIndexQuery


Method Summary
 void add(EventBean[] eventsPerStream, java.util.Map value, java.util.Collection<EventBean> result)
           
 void add(EventBean theEvent, java.util.Map value, java.util.Set<EventBean> result)
           
 java.util.Collection<EventBean> get(EventBean[] eventsPerStream, java.util.Map parent, ExprEvaluatorContext context)
           
 java.util.Set<EventBean> get(EventBean theEvent, java.util.Map parent, ExprEvaluatorContext context)
           
 java.util.Collection<EventBean> getCollectKeys(EventBean[] eventsPerStream, java.util.Map parent, ExprEvaluatorContext context, java.util.ArrayList<java.lang.Object> keys)
           
 java.util.Set<EventBean> getCollectKeys(EventBean theEvent, java.util.Map parent, ExprEvaluatorContext context, java.util.ArrayList<java.lang.Object> keys)
           
 void setNext(CompositeIndexQuery next)
           
 

Method Detail

add

void add(EventBean theEvent,
         java.util.Map value,
         java.util.Set<EventBean> result)

add

void add(EventBean[] eventsPerStream,
         java.util.Map value,
         java.util.Collection<EventBean> result)

get

java.util.Set<EventBean> get(EventBean theEvent,
                             java.util.Map parent,
                             ExprEvaluatorContext context)

get

java.util.Collection<EventBean> get(EventBean[] eventsPerStream,
                                    java.util.Map parent,
                                    ExprEvaluatorContext context)

getCollectKeys

java.util.Set<EventBean> getCollectKeys(EventBean theEvent,
                                        java.util.Map parent,
                                        ExprEvaluatorContext context,
                                        java.util.ArrayList<java.lang.Object> keys)

getCollectKeys

java.util.Collection<EventBean> getCollectKeys(EventBean[] eventsPerStream,
                                               java.util.Map parent,
                                               ExprEvaluatorContext context,
                                               java.util.ArrayList<java.lang.Object> keys)

setNext

void setNext(CompositeIndexQuery next)

© 2006-2015 EsperTech Inc.
All rights reserved.
Visit us at espertech.com